Playa del Inglés Weather in April

April is when Playa del Inglés fully wakes up after the quiet winter period. Temperatures reach 22°C, rainfall is almost non-existent — just 9mm across 2 days — and the beach season shifts into gear. Easter brings one of the busiest periods of the year, and the resort fills with families and couples from across northern Europe. The south coast in April has a particular energy — warm enough for beach days, dry enough for outdoor evenings, and lively enough to feel like a genuine summer holiday without the intensity of August. The Yumbo Centre and the esplanade restaurants are all in full operation.

Climate Detail

Sunshine holds at 8 hours per day, and the UV index reaches 7 — proper summer sun protection is now required. April winds are strong but less consistent than March, and the afternoons are more likely to produce calm, comfortable beach conditions. Sea temperature remains at 19°C — cool for swimming but fine for those who enjoy a refreshing dip. April evenings are noticeably warmer than winter — 17°C is comfortable for outdoor dining without a heavy jacket. The long days (up to 13 hours of daylight) mean that activities can be planned across the full day without time pressure.

What to Do in April

Beach life at spring capacity

April beach days are genuinely summer-like — warm sun, long days, and a lively esplanade. Book sunbeds early during Easter week.

Semana Santa

Holy Week processions and ceremonies are held across Gran Canaria in Easter. The south coast maintains full tourist operation but locals celebrate with traditional events.

Aqualand Maspalomas

The water park opens for the spring season — an excellent family option for Easter week.

Watersports and boat trips

April sea conditions are good for beginner surf lessons, paddleboarding, and catamaran excursions along the south coast.

Sunset esplanade walks

The long April evenings make sunset walks along the Playa del Inglés esplanade memorable — the light on the dunes at dusk is spectacular.

What to Pack

  • Light summer clothing for the day
  • A light layer for evenings — still needed at 17°C with a breeze
  • Sunscreen SPF 50 — UV index reaches 7
  • Swimwear for beach and pool
  • Comfortable sandals or shoes for esplanade walking

Is April crowded in Playa del Inglés?+

Easter week is one of the busiest periods of the year in Playa del Inglés. Outside Easter, April is noticeably busier than winter but calmer than summer. Booking accommodation in advance is essential for Easter itself.

Is Playa del Inglés good for families in April?+

April is excellent for families — warm weather, the beach, Aqualand water park, and Palmitos Park. Easter week in particular is well-catered for families, with full resort facilities and manageable temperatures for children.
